Med-Term Goals (3-5 Years):
- Become an NSWOC (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y, and Continence)
Strategies to achieve this goal:
- Enroll in a recognized program, such as the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y, and Continence Education Program (NSWOCEP), provided by the Canadian Association for Enterostomal Therapy (CAET).
- Prepare for and successfully pass the certification exam to obtain a NSWOC designation.
- Take on mentorship roles to guide and support new nurses entering the field.
- Regularly update my knowledge through research and professional.
